As a result of the physical inspection, as well as checking the belongings of Georgian and foreign citizens, and the vehicles driven by them at the customs checkpoint of the Revenue Service of the Ministry of Finance – “Sarpi”, customs officers detected undeclared gold (weight – 99.11 grams) and silver (weight – 335.33 grams) jewelry.
The total customs value of the undeclared goods amounted to 26,066 GEL.
The case materials against the foreign citizen who violated the law were transferred to the Investigation Service of the Ministry of Finance for further action, and the citizen was fined 1,000 GEL for the violation provided for in Part 1 of Article 168 of the Customs Code of Georgia.
